Explanation:
The question is testing how to add multiple time blocks and then round the result to two decimal places in hours. You start by converting every segment to hours, add them all, and then apply the rounding rule: look at the third decimal place; if it’s 5 or more, increase the second decimal by one, otherwise keep it. In this problem, the total time, after summing all parts, ends up as a number that rounds to 4.17 hours. That means the sum’s hundredths place is 7 and the thousandths place is less than 5, so the two-decimal value is 4.17. The other options would require a total that rounds to a different hundredth, which isn’t what the calculated sum yields.
